POJ 1936
2015-06-10 16:51
337 查看
#include<iostream> #include<string> using namespace std; int main() { //freopen("acm.acm","r",stdin); string s1; string s2; int len_1; int len_2; int i; int j; int index; while(cin>>s1>>s2) { // cout<<s1<<endl; // cout<<s2<<endl; len_1 = s1.length(); len_2 = s2.length(); index = 0; for(i = 0; i < len_1; ++ i) { for(j = index; j < len_2; ++ j) { if(s1[i] == s2[j]) { index = j+1; break; } } if(j == len_2) { break; } } if(i == len_1) { cout<<"Yes"<<endl; } else { cout<<"No"<<endl; } } }
相关文章推荐
- POJ 1940
- JAVA中获得一个月最大天数的方法(备忘)
- 哈希表(Hash table)(1)
- 使用log4j让日志写入数据库
- 我不是来黑小兔子的。【来点humor】
- 在Linux上安装ArcGIS许可管理器备忘录
- Multipart/form-data POST文件上传分析
- web service(SOAP)与HTTP接口的区别
- POJ 3206 最小生成树
- Linux 命令
- inode、软连接、硬链接
- POJ 1928
- POJ 1906
- POJ 1915
- windows 10预览版系统怎么调整电脑颜色?
- C语言 判断二叉树是不是平衡树
- Iptables 指南 1.1.19
- 集锦3
- github 设置SSH
- 中值滤波实现